Starter Motor Drive Gear and Flywheel Ring Gear Inspection

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2007 Lincoln Mark LT and 2007 Ford Pickup.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Check the wear patterns on the starter drive and the flywheel ring gear. If the wear pattern is not normal, install a new starter motor. For additional information, refer to Starter Motor - 4.2L  or Starter Motor - 4.6L, 5.4L  in this article.
  2. Fig 1: Checking Wear Patterns On Starter Drive And Flywheel Ring Gear
    GF0002881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  3. If the starter drive gear and the flywheel ring gear are not fully meshing or the gears are milled or damaged, install a new starter motor. For additional information, refer to Starter Motor - 4.2L  or Starter Motor - 4.6L, 5.4L  in this article. Install a new flywheel or flexplate. For additional information, refer to ENGINE - 4.2L article, ENGINE - 4.6L (2V) article or ENGINE - 5.4L (3V) article.
